Why These Are the Top Volkswagen Repair Auto Repair Shops in Laupahoehoe

** The Volkswagen repair market for Laupahoehoe residents is regionalized, requiring travel to Hilo (a 30-45 minute drive) or, for more advanced diagnostics, to Kona (a 2+ hour drive). There are no repair shops physically located in Laupahoehoe that specialize in the complex, computer-dependent systems of modern Volkswagens. **Average Quality:** The quality of service is high among the specialized shops, as they must compete with the lone Volkswagen dealership on the island (in Kona) and handle a diverse fleet of European cars. Technicians at these top shops are typically ASE certified, with some having manufacturer-specific training. **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ate. While there are many general repair shops, only a handful possess the proprietary software (VCDS/VAG-COM), diagnostic tools, and direct experience to properly service VW's TSI/TDI engines, DSG transmissions, and 4MOTION systems. This specialization allows the top providers to command premium pricing. **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ates are high, typically ranging from **$150 - $190 per hour**, reflecting Hawaii's higher cost of living and the specialized nature of the work. Parts often have significant shipping costs and delays from the mainland. Complex jobs like a DSG service or turbocharger replacement can easily exceed $1,500-$3,000. Owners of newer EVs and vehicles under warranty are often still directed to the dealership in Kona for certain services.

Are Volkswagen repairs more expensive in Hawaii due to our location?

Yes, parts costs can be higher due to shipping and limited local inventory, often leading to longer wait times for specific components. Labor rates in Hawaii are also generally above the national average, so obtaining a detailed estimate before authorizing repairs is crucial for budgeting.

What are the most common Volkswagen issues to watch for given Laupahoehoe's climate and roads?

The humid, salty coastal air can accelerate corrosion, particularly on brake lines, exhaust components, and electrical connections. Additionally, the winding and sometimes rough roads of the Hamakua Coast can lead to increased wear on suspension components, tires, and wheel alignments on VWs.

When should I seek service for my Volkswagen's check engine light around here?

Seek diagnosis immediately if the light is flashing or if you notice a loss of power, as driving to Hilo with a serious misfire can cause further damage. For a steady light, schedule a scan soon, as underlying issues can affect fuel efficiency, which is important given the long distances to major services on the Big Island.

What local driving considerations should influence my Volkswagen's maintenance schedule in Laupahoehoe?

The frequent rain and occasional volcanic haze (vog) mean cabin air filters and windshield wipers need more frequent replacement. Also, the constant use of air conditioning due to humidity puts extra load on the cooling system and battery, making regular checks of these systems essential.
